Войти
Регистрация
Спроси ai-bota
В
Все
У
Українська література
Г
Геометрия
Д
Другие предметы
Э
Экономика
Г
География
О
ОБЖ
М
Математика
М
МХК
Х
Химия
Қ
Қазақ тiлi
Л
Литература
У
Українська мова
О
Обществознание
Ф
Физика
А
Английский язык
А
Алгебра
И
История
Б
Беларуская мова
Б
Биология
М
Музыка
П
Право
И
Информатика
П
Психология
В
Видео-ответы
Н
Немецкий язык
Ф
Французский язык
О
Окружающий мир
Р
Русский язык
Показать больше
Показать меньше
ann396
01.11.2020 08:51 •
Информатика
Дано двузначное число. определить: а) входит ли в него цифра 3; б) входит ли в него цифра а. написать на visual studio
Ответ:
vikabosch
08.10.2020 22:57
#include <iostream>
int main()
{
int
number,
val,
digits;
bool query[2]{false, false};
std::cout << "Введите число: ";
std::cin >> number;
std::cout << std::endl << "Введите цифру, которую нужно найти в числе: ";
std::cin >> val;
while(number)
{
digits = number % 10;
number /= 10;
if(digits == 3)
query[0] = true;
else if(digits == val)
query[1] = true;
}
if(query[0])
std::cout << "Число 3 входит" << std::endl;
else std::cout << "Число 3 не входит" << std::endl;
if(query[1])
std::cout << "Число " << val << " входит" << std::endl;
else std::cout << "Число " << val << " не входит" << std::endl;
}
0,0
(0 оценок)
Популярные вопросы: Информатика
dariyaomelchen
22.05.2022 01:06
Определить объём видеопамяти для графического режима с разрешением 800х600 точек и глубиной цвета 24 бита.выразить мбт...
123фидан321
06.09.2021 14:38
Информационное сообщение объемом 6000 битов состоит из 100 символов.найти информационный вес символа и мощность алфавита....
nastea030
04.02.2020 11:52
Придумать сказку по вычислительной техники. буду !...
omsbksrj
04.02.2020 11:52
Даны a и n. вычислите s=(a+1)^2+(a+2)^2+…+(a+n)^2 в паскале, нужно...
Joom372
09.11.2022 15:29
Ввести три числа, найти их сумму, произведение и среднее арифметическое пример введите три числа 4 5 7 4+5+7=16 4×5×7=140 (4+5+7)÷3=5.333333...
ЕсенжоловаЛяззат
02.06.2023 01:31
Маша и оля собрались варить варенье из акг вишни.по рецепту на 3 кг вишни нужно 7 кг сахара.оля сказала,что нужно купить дкг сахара,а маша сказала сто хкг сахара.кто из них...
katyakot2299
22.02.2021 16:38
Нужна ,напишите решение примеров 1. 0.+0.0011 сложить в двоичной системе 2. 1101*101 умножить в двоичной системе 3. 345.2+177.3 сложить в восьмеричной системе 4. 0.33*7.5 умножить...
kirillmrX
11.05.2023 17:01
нужно решение примеров 1. 7,5 переведите из десятичной в двоичную 2. 34,07 переведите из десятичной в восьмеричную 3. 22,08 переведите из десятичной в шестнадцатеричную 4....
Денис121009
05.09.2022 11:06
Eaa(16 ричная система) +c 1 7(16ричная система)...
Andy01
05.09.2022 11:06
10100011(двоичная сист.) - 1100101(двоичная сист.)...
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
int main()
{
int
number,
val,
digits;
bool query[2]{false, false};
std::cout << "Введите число: ";
std::cin >> number;
std::cout << std::endl << "Введите цифру, которую нужно найти в числе: ";
std::cin >> val;
while(number)
{
digits = number % 10;
number /= 10;
if(digits == 3)
query[0] = true;
else if(digits == val)
query[1] = true;
}
if(query[0])
std::cout << "Число 3 входит" << std::endl;
else std::cout << "Число 3 не входит" << std::endl;
if(query[1])
std::cout << "Число " << val << " входит" << std::endl;
else std::cout << "Число " << val << " не входит" << std::endl;
}